Zusammenfassung: | This study examined the role of the internal design department and its collaboration with construction manager and the client during the design process by the UK construction company Laing O'Rourke (LOR). The results are as follows: (1) In the early stages of design, personnel from architectural design in LOR works flexibly with the client to set the design conditions. The structural/facilities designers and construction teams are involved in the design process to clarify the cost and construction schedule; (2) The design team coordinates with the client, architect, and construction team on issues that arise during the design process; (3) The initial design work is carried out collaboratively free of charge; (4) The construction team signs Pre‐Construction Service Agreement (PCSA) with the client and carries out preconstruction contract; (5) The design specifications are gradually clarified and the construction contract is concluded in stages; (6) The client and construction company works together with shared objectives and shared necessary information. |
